  8. Given the choice between Turbo Diesel and Turbo Petrol, I would pick Petrol!! I own a Fabia vRS with the VAG group 1.9TDi engine, and have test driven a couple of Octavia vRS with the VAG group 1.8T engine! The TDI is more torquey, which makes for great motorway driving and overtaking! The power comes in one big lump and throws you in the back of the seat! You can floor it at 2000RPM and you get a big surge of power but it soon runs out of puff and you change up at about 3500RPM (which is fine when overtaking but not good from a standing start!) and its not exactly a refined engine and the weight effects the handling! The 1.8T however, its MUCH more refined, which a smooth power delivery right up to the redline. Where the TDI feels quick with the torque, the 1.8T IS quick! Have only test driven a couple so can't comment a great deal but was a MUCH nicer engine to drive with than the TDI. Economy though, the TDI's take AGES to warm up so not great for short winter journeys or clearing the screen with the blowers but its a diesel so go on forever when warmed up! The 1.8T is more economical than I thought (according to Parkers its better than a Focus ST170 and a few other N/A alternatives with similar BHP figures!) so shouldn't be much difference than a 2.0 Escort. Maybe even better!
